L'automatisation des processus métier (BPA) révolutionne la façon dont les entreprises opèrent dans le monde numérique d'aujourd'hui. Cette technologie permet d'optimiser les flux de travail, de réduire les erreurs et d'améliorer l'efficacité globale. Pour les débutants, naviguer dans cet univers peut sembler intimidant, mais avec les bons outils et conseils, il est possible de tirer parti de cette puissante ressource. Explorons ensemble les fondamentaux de l'automatisation des processus et découvrons comment elle peut transformer votre entreprise.
Fondamentaux de l'automatisation des processus métier (BPA)
L'automatisation des processus métier consiste à utiliser la technologie pour exécuter des tâches répétitives ou prédéfinies sans intervention humaine. Elle englobe une variété de techniques et d'outils conçus pour rationaliser les opérations commerciales. L'objectif principal est d'améliorer l'efficacité, la précision et la cohérence des processus de l'entreprise.
Les avantages de l'automatisation sont nombreux. Elle permet de réduire les coûts opérationnels, d'augmenter la productivité et d'améliorer la qualité des produits ou services. De plus, elle libère les employés des tâches monotones, leur permettant de se concentrer sur des activités à plus forte valeur ajoutée. L'automatisation joue également un rôle crucial dans la transformation numérique des entreprises, en facilitant l'adoption de nouvelles technologies et en favorisant l'innovation.
Il est important de noter que l'automatisation n'est pas une solution universelle. Certains processus sont plus adaptés à l'automatisation que d'autres. En général, les tâches répétitives, basées sur des règles et à haut volume sont les meilleures candidates. Par exemple, le traitement des factures, la gestion des stocks ou la génération de rapports sont des domaines où l'automatisation peut apporter des bénéfices significatifs.
L'automatisation des processus métier est comme un assistant virtuel infatigable, capable de gérer les tâches répétitives 24 heures sur 24, 7 jours sur 7, sans jamais prendre de pause café.
Pour réussir dans l'automatisation, il est essentiel de comprendre les différents types de BPA. On distingue généralement trois catégories principales :
- L'automatisation basée sur les règles : Elle suit des instructions prédéfinies pour exécuter des tâches simples.
- L'automatisation cognitive : Elle utilise l'intelligence artificielle pour prendre des décisions basées sur des données complexes.
- L'automatisation robotique des processus (RPA) : Elle imite les actions humaines pour interagir avec des systèmes existants.
Chaque type d'automatisation a ses propres forces et cas d'utilisation. Le choix dépendra de la nature des processus à automatiser et des objectifs spécifiques de l'entreprise. Maintenant que nous avons posé les bases, explorons les outils essentiels pour les débutants en automatisation.
Outils d'automatisation essentiels pour débutants
Pour les novices en automatisation, il existe une variété d'outils conviviaux qui peuvent grandement faciliter la mise en œuvre de processus automatisés. Ces outils sont conçus pour être accessibles même sans compétences avancées en programmation. Voici quelques-uns des outils les plus populaires et efficaces pour débuter dans l'automatisation des processus.
Zapier : intégration et automatisation multi-applications
Zapier est une plateforme d'automatisation puissante qui permet de connecter et d'automatiser des tâches entre différentes applications web. Son interface intuitive permet aux utilisateurs de créer des « Zaps » , qui sont des flux de travail automatisés reliant deux ou plusieurs applications. Par exemple, vous pouvez automatiser l'envoi d'un message Slack chaque fois qu'un nouveau lead est ajouté à votre CRM.
L'un des principaux avantages de Zapier est sa vaste bibliothèque d'intégrations, couvrant plus de 3000 applications. Cela signifie que vous pouvez probablement automatiser des processus impliquant les outils que vous utilisez déjà quotidiennement. De plus, Zapier propose des modèles prédéfinis pour les automatisations courantes, ce qui facilite encore davantage la prise en main pour les débutants.
Microsoft power automate : flux de travail personnalisés
Microsoft Power Automate, anciennement connu sous le nom de Microsoft Flow, est un outil d'automatisation robuste intégré à l'écosystème Microsoft 365. Il permet de créer des flux de travail automatisés au sein des applications Microsoft et au-delà. Power Automate brille particulièrement dans l'automatisation des processus d'entreprise qui impliquent des applications Microsoft comme Office 365, SharePoint ou Dynamics 365.
L'un des atouts de Power Automate est sa capacité à créer des flux complexes avec des conditions, des boucles et des approbations. Il offre également des fonctionnalités d'IA et de traitement du langage naturel, permettant d'automatiser des tâches plus sophistiquées. Pour les entreprises déjà investies dans l'écosystème Microsoft, Power Automate représente une solution d'automatisation naturelle et puissante.
IFTTT : automatisation des tâches quotidiennes
IFTTT (If This Then That) est une plateforme d'automatisation simple mais efficace, idéale pour les débutants. Son concept repose sur la création d' « applets » , qui sont des règles d'automatisation basées sur le principe « si ceci se produit, alors faire cela ». IFTTT est particulièrement utile pour automatiser des tâches personnelles et des interactions entre appareils connectés.
Par exemple, vous pouvez créer un applet qui enregistre automatiquement vos tweets dans une feuille de calcul Google, ou qui allume vos lumières intelligentes lorsque vous arrivez à la maison. IFTTT est gratuit pour un usage de base, ce qui en fait une excellente option pour commencer à explorer l'automatisation sans investissement initial.
Uipath : automatisation robotisée des processus (RPA)
UiPath est un leader dans le domaine de l'automatisation robotisée des processus (RPA). Contrairement aux outils précédents qui se concentrent sur l'intégration d'applications web, UiPath permet d'automatiser des interactions avec des logiciels de bureau, des applications web et même des systèmes hérités. Il utilise des « robots logiciels » pour imiter les actions humaines, comme cliquer sur des boutons, saisir des données ou naviguer dans des interfaces.
Bien que UiPath soit plus complexe que Zapier ou IFTTT, il offre une interface visuelle de développement qui le rend accessible aux utilisateurs non techniques. Il est particulièrement utile pour automatiser des processus métier complexes qui impliquent plusieurs systèmes et applications. UiPath propose également une version communautaire gratuite, permettant aux débutants de s'initier à la RPA sans coût initial.
L'automatisation des processus est comme construire un pont entre différentes îles d'information dans votre entreprise, permettant un flux continu et efficace de données et d'actions.
Ces outils offrent un excellent point de départ pour les débutants en automatisation. Cependant, avant de se lancer dans l'utilisation de ces outils, il est crucial d'identifier correctement les processus qui bénéficieraient le plus de l'automatisation. Examinons maintenant les techniques pour identifier ces opportunités d'automatisation.
Techniques d'identification des processus à automatiser
L'identification des processus appropriés pour l'automatisation est une étape cruciale pour garantir le succès de vos efforts d'automatisation. Il ne s'agit pas simplement d'automatiser pour le plaisir d'automatiser, mais de cibler les processus qui apporteront le plus de valeur à votre entreprise. Voici quelques techniques efficaces pour identifier ces processus.
Analyse des flux de travail avec la méthode SIPOC
La méthode SIPOC (Supplier, Input, Process, Output, Customer) est un outil puissant pour analyser et comprendre les flux de travail. Elle permet de visualiser un processus de bout en bout, en identifiant les fournisseurs, les entrées, les étapes du processus, les sorties et les clients. Cette approche holistique aide à repérer les inefficacités et les opportunités d'automatisation.
Pour utiliser SIPOC, commencez par créer un tableau avec cinq colonnes correspondant à chaque élément du SIPOC. Remplissez chaque colonne en détaillant les aspects pertinents du processus. Cette visualisation vous aidera à identifier les étapes répétitives, les goulots d'étranglement et les points de friction qui pourraient bénéficier de l'automatisation.
Cartographie des processus et identification des goulots d'étranglement
La cartographie des processus est une technique visuelle qui permet de représenter graphiquement les étapes d'un processus. Elle aide à comprendre comment le travail circule à travers différentes fonctions et départements. En créant une carte détaillée de vos processus, vous pouvez facilement identifier les goulots d'étranglement, les redondances et les étapes qui ralentissent le flux de travail.
Utilisez des outils de cartographie des processus comme Lucidchart
ou Microsoft Visio
pour créer des diagrammes de flux. Recherchez les points où le processus ralentit, les étapes qui nécessitent beaucoup d'interventions manuelles, ou les tâches qui sont fréquemment retardées. Ces zones sont souvent d'excellents candidats pour l'automatisation.
Évaluation du retour sur investissement (ROI) de l'automatisation
Une fois que vous avez identifié des processus potentiels à automatiser, il est crucial d'évaluer le retour sur investissement (ROI) de chaque opportunité d'automatisation. Cette évaluation vous aidera à prioriser vos efforts d'automatisation et à justifier les investissements nécessaires.
Pour calculer le ROI, estimez les coûts associés à l'automatisation (licences logicielles, formation, mise en œuvre) et comparez-les aux économies potentielles (temps économisé, réduction des erreurs, augmentation de la productivité). N'oubliez pas de prendre en compte les avantages intangibles comme l'amélioration de la satisfaction des employés ou de la qualité du service client.
Critère | Avant Automatisation | Après Automatisation | Impact |
---|---|---|---|
Temps de traitement | 2 heures | 15 minutes | 87,5% de réduction |
Taux d'erreur | 5% | 0,5% | 90% de réduction |
Coût par transaction | 50€ | 10€ | 80% d'économie |
Une fois que vous avez identifié les processus à automatiser et évalué leur potentiel ROI, vous êtes prêt à passer à l'étape suivante : la mise en œuvre de l'automatisation. Cette phase cruciale nécessite une approche structurée pour garantir le succès de votre initiative d'automatisation.
Mise en œuvre de l'automatisation : étapes clés
La mise en œuvre de l'automatisation des processus est une étape cruciale qui nécessite une planification minutieuse et une exécution méthodique. Voici les étapes clés à suivre pour assurer le succès de votre projet d'automatisation.
Conception de workflows avec la notation BPMN 2.0
La Business Process Model and Notation (BPMN) 2.0 est un standard largement adopté pour la modélisation des processus métier. Elle fournit un langage visuel commun qui peut être compris par les parties prenantes techniques et non techniques. Utiliser BPMN 2.0 pour concevoir vos workflows automatisés présente plusieurs avantages :
- Clarté et cohérence dans la représentation des processus
- Facilité de communication entre les équipes métier et IT
- Possibilité de traduire directement les modèles en workflows exécutables
Pour concevoir vos workflows avec BPMN 2.0, utilisez des outils spécialisés comme Camunda Modeler
ou Bizagi Modeler
. Ces outils vous permettent de créer des diagrammes détaillés de vos processus, en incluant tous les éléments nécessaires comme les tâches, les événements, les passerelles et les flux de données.
Prototypage rapide avec des outils low-code
Le prototypage rapide est une approche efficace pour tester et affiner vos idées d'automatisation avant de s'engager dans un développement à grande échelle. Les plateformes low-code sont particulièrement adaptées à cette phase, car elles permettent de créer rapidement des versions fonctionnelles de vos processus automatisés sans nécessiter de compétences avancées en programmation.
Des outils comme OutSystems ou Mendix offrent des environnements de développement visuels où vous pouvez créer des applications et des workflows par glisser-déposer. Cette approche vous permet de :
- Valider rapidement vos concepts d'automatisation
- Obtenir des retours précoces des utilisateurs finaux
- Itérer et améliorer vos processus avant la mise en œuvre finale
Tests et débogage des processus automatisés
Une fois votre prototype développé, il est crucial de procéder à des tests approfondis pour s'assurer que votre processus automatisé fonctionne comme prévu. Cette phase de test devrait couvrir différents aspects :
- Tests fonctionn
Pour le débogage, utilisez les outils intégrés à votre plateforme d'automatisation. Par exemple, UiPath Studio offre des fonctionnalités de débogage avancées qui vous permettent d'exécuter votre processus pas à pas et d'inspecter les variables à chaque étape. N'oubliez pas de tester votre processus avec différents scénarios et jeux de données pour garantir sa robustesse.
Déploiement progressif et gestion du changement
Le déploiement d'un processus automatisé ne se limite pas à l'aspect technique. Il implique également une gestion efficace du changement pour assurer l'adoption et le succès à long terme. Voici quelques étapes clés pour un déploiement réussi :
- Commencez par un pilote : Déployez votre automatisation auprès d'un groupe restreint d'utilisateurs pour recueillir des retours et identifier les ajustements nécessaires.
- Formez les utilisateurs : Organisez des sessions de formation pour familiariser les employés avec le nouveau processus automatisé.
- Communiquez clairement : Expliquez les avantages de l'automatisation et comment elle affectera le travail quotidien.
- Fournissez un support continu : Mettez en place un système de support pour aider les utilisateurs pendant la transition.
En adoptant une approche progressive et en impliquant les utilisateurs tout au long du processus, vous augmentez considérablement les chances de succès de votre initiative d'automatisation.
Meilleures pratiques pour l'automatisation des processus
Pour maximiser les bénéfices de l'automatisation et éviter les pièges courants, il est essentiel de suivre certaines meilleures pratiques. Voici quelques recommandations clés pour réussir votre projet d'automatisation.
Standardisation des processus avant l'automatisation
Avant de se lancer dans l'automatisation, il est crucial de standardiser vos processus. La standardisation implique de définir et de documenter clairement chaque étape du processus, en éliminant les variations inutiles et en optimisant le flux de travail. Cette étape est fondamentale car :
- Elle simplifie l'automatisation en réduisant la complexité
- Elle permet d'identifier et d'éliminer les inefficacités avant l'automatisation
- Elle facilite la maintenance et les mises à jour futures du processus automatisé
Utilisez des outils de modélisation de processus comme Lucidchart
ou Microsoft Visio
pour documenter vos processus standardisés. Impliquez les parties prenantes clés dans cet exercice pour garantir que tous les aspects du processus sont pris en compte.
Sécurisation des flux de données automatisés
La sécurité est un aspect crucial de l'automatisation des processus, en particulier lorsqu'il s'agit de données sensibles ou confidentielles. Voici quelques pratiques essentielles pour sécuriser vos flux de données automatisés :
- Chiffrement des données : Assurez-vous que toutes les données en transit et au repos sont chiffrées.
- Contrôle d'accès : Mettez en place des contrôles d'accès stricts basés sur le principe du moindre privilège.
- Journalisation et surveillance : Implémentez une journalisation complète et surveillez régulièrement les activités anormales.
- Conformité réglementaire : Assurez-vous que votre automatisation respecte les réglementations applicables comme le RGPD.
Considérez l'utilisation de solutions de sécurité spécialisées comme CyberArk
pour la gestion des identités et des accès privilégiés dans vos processus automatisés.
Maintenance et mise à jour continue des processus
L'automatisation n'est pas un projet ponctuel, mais un processus continu d'amélioration et d'adaptation. Pour maintenir l'efficacité de vos processus automatisés :
- Effectuez des revues régulières : Examinez périodiquement vos processus pour identifier les opportunités d'optimisation.
- Surveillez les performances : Utilisez des outils d'analyse pour suivre les KPIs de vos processus automatisés.
- Restez à jour avec les technologies : Suivez les évolutions technologiques et mettez à jour vos outils si nécessaire.
- Formez continuellement votre équipe : Assurez-vous que votre équipe reste compétente sur les dernières pratiques d'automatisation.
Considérez l'utilisation d'outils de gestion de processus comme Celonis
pour une surveillance et une optimisation continues de vos processus automatisés.
Défis courants et solutions pour l'automatisation des débutants
Bien que l'automatisation offre de nombreux avantages, les débutants peuvent rencontrer certains défis lors de sa mise en œuvre. Voici quelques problèmes courants et des solutions pour les surmonter :
Résistance au changement
La résistance des employés est l'un des obstacles les plus fréquents à l'automatisation. Pour y faire face :
- Communiquez clairement les avantages de l'automatisation pour les employés
- Impliquez les utilisateurs finaux dès le début du processus d'automatisation
- Offrez une formation adéquate et un support continu
Complexité technique
Les débutants peuvent se sentir dépassés par les aspects techniques de l'automatisation. Pour surmonter ce défi :
- Commencez par des projets simples et augmentez progressivement la complexité
- Utilisez des outils low-code ou no-code pour réduire la barrière technique
- Envisagez de faire appel à des experts externes pour les projets plus complexes
Intégration avec les systèmes existants
L'intégration de l'automatisation avec les systèmes existants peut être délicate. Pour faciliter ce processus :
- Effectuez un audit complet de votre infrastructure IT avant de commencer
- Choisissez des outils d'automatisation avec de bonnes capacités d'intégration
- Testez rigoureusement les intégrations avant le déploiement complet
En anticipant ces défis et en préparant des solutions, vous augmentez considérablement vos chances de réussite dans votre parcours d'automatisation.
L'automatisation des processus est un voyage, pas une destination. Chaque défi surmonté vous rapproche d'une entreprise plus efficace et plus innovante.